Blossom Express up & running after COVID shutdown

The Blossom Express is back.

The Ripon bus resumed operations after being idle since March due to the COVID-19 pandemic.

Last week the Blossom Express was on the road again accompanied with several new health and safety protocols.

According to the City of Ripon, the local bus will continue operating on Tuesdays and Thursdays on a fixed route service.

Stops include the Save Mart Shopping Center and the Ripon Memorial Library, and Modesto to the Vintage Faire Mall and the Target Center.

According to the City of Ripon website (www.cityofripon.org), the Blossom Express can deviate with ¾ mile of the bus stop available upon request.

Some of the bus stops are available to connect to eTrans (Escalon) at Dale Road and Veneman Avenue in Modesto, along with RTD (San Joaquin County) and MAX (Stanislaus County) bus lines.

Blossom Express is equipped with two bike racks – riders are responsible for loading and unloading their bikes – and a Lift Ramp for mobility devices.
